Elon Musk's entrepreneurial journey has been shaped by a web of relationships that span family, mentors, and collaborators. His mother, Maye Musk, played a pivotal role in instilling resilience and independence, often emphasizing the importance of hard work and self-reliance. His father, Errol Musk, introduced him to engineering and technology, sparking an early interest in innovation. Mentors like Peter Thiel, co-founder of PayPal, provided critical guidance during Musk's early ventures, helping him navigate the tech industry's complexities. Collaborations with key figures like JB Straubel at Tesla and Gwynne Shotwell at SpaceX were instrumental in turning his ambitious visions into reality. These relationships not only influenced his technical expertise but also shaped his leadership style and risk-taking mentality, which are hallmarks of his success.

Another layer of influence comes from his partnerships with other entrepreneurs. Musk’s work with his brother Kimbal Musk on ventures like Zip2 and later on sustainable food initiatives highlights the importance of familial collaboration. Additionally, his interactions with visionaries like Larry Page of Google and Steve Jobs of Apple provided him with insights into scaling businesses and maintaining innovation. Even rivalries, such as his competitive dynamic with Jeff Bezos, fueled his drive to push boundaries. These relationships, both supportive and challenging, have been crucial in molding Musk into the entrepreneur he is today, demonstrating how personal and professional connections can profoundly impact one’s journey.

I recently dove into 'Elon Musk: Biography of a Self-Made Visionary' and was struck by how vividly it painted the people who shaped his journey. Obviously, Elon himself is the central figure—his relentless drive, chaotic brilliance, and almost surreal ambition leap off the page. But the book also highlights pivotal relationships, like his first wife, Justine Musk, who offers a grounded counterpoint to his whirlwind life. Then there’s his brother Kimbal, whose quieter but steady support contrasts Elon’s meteoric rise. The narrative doesn’t shy away from his professional collisions either, like the tense dynamic with PayPal co-founder Peter Thiel or the fraught but transformative partnership with Tesla’s early team, especially JB Straubel. What fascinated me most, though, were the lesser-known figures—like his mentor at Zip2, Greg Kouri, who saw potential in Elon when he was just a scrappy entrepreneur. The book threads these relationships into a tapestry that humanizes someone often seen as a meme or a myth. Even his adversaries, like short-seller Jim Chanos, add depth by forcing Elon to defend his vision. It’s not just a story of one man; it’s about the ecosystem of people who fueled, challenged, and sometimes clashed with his world-changing ideas. By the end, I felt like I’d met a whole cast of characters who made Elon’s saga feel less like a superhero story and more like a messy, human odyssey.
